At the end of every meal in Japan,
people put their palms together, bow their heads,
and whisper one word:
"Gochisousama."
Most tourists learn it as "Thank you for the meal."
That translation misses the entire soul of the language.
Look at the kanji characters:
馳 (chi) and 走 (sou).
Both mean the exact same thing: to gallop. To run hard.
"Chisou" literally means running around frantically.
Centuries ago, before refrigeration or supermarkets,
putting a warm meal on a table meant someone had to run:
the farmer sweating in muddy paddy fields,
the fisherman fighting waves at 3:00 a.m.,
the horse courier galloping between towns with fresh ingredients,
the cook standing in choking smoke over an open fire.
When you say Gochisousama, you are not saying "the food was tasty."
You are bowing to every pair of feet
that ran across the earth so you could eat tonight.
And you leave not a single grain of rice in the bowl.
Because leaving a grain behind
means someone ran for nothing.

You train to protect your mitochondria from aging. And it works. Exercise preserves mitochondrial energy production into your 90s. But a 2025 study by @GGouspillou and colleagues reveals there's a second mitochondrial function that declines with age no matter how much you exercise.
Gouspillou and his colleagues at Université du Québec à Montréal divided 139 men aged 20 to 93 into active and inactive groups. They measured physical performance, muscle composition, and three critical mitochondrial functions: energy production, free radical generation, and calcium handling capacity.
The conventional wisdom says mitochondria wear out with age, becoming a leaky metabolic engine that produces more oxidative stress and becomes less capable of taking nutrients and converting them into ATP.
Direct measurement across 73 years of aging shows that's not necessarily correct.
Mitochondrial energy production stayed completely stable in active participants from their 20s through their 90s.
A 90-year-old who stayed active had mitochondria that produced energy like a 20-year-old. Inactive individuals showed declining energy production, but it tracked with how little they moved, not how many years they'd lived.
When normalized to mitochondrial content, the differences disappeared entirely. The study suggests that aging doesn't break energy production. Physical inactivity reduces how many mitochondria you maintain. Each individual mitochondrion works just as well at 90 as at 20.
Free radical production, blamed for decades as an aging driver, showed no increase with age. Active participants actually produced more free radicals than inactive individuals while displaying superior strength and performance. The free radical theory of muscle aging didn't hold.
The study had some interesting headlines:
• Physical activity protects performance across the lifespan but doesn't completely prevent age-related decline
• Mitochondrial energy production depends on activity level, not chronological age
• Free radical production remains stable with aging and reflects mitochondrial health, not damage
• Mitochondrial calcium handling capacity drops sharply after age 60 in both active and inactive individuals
• Reduced calcium handling correlates with lower muscle mass, strength, and performance
• Deterioration accelerates dramatically after 60 rather than declining gradually
The calcium handling finding represents the first mitochondrial function that deteriorates with aging regardless of exercise. Mitochondria normally act as calcium buffers, absorbing excess calcium to keep cells functioning properly. When this buffering capacity fails, a protective channel called the permeability transition pore opens too easily.
Think of it like a circuit breaker that's supposed to trip only during emergencies but starts tripping at lower and lower thresholds. When the pore opens prematurely, stored calcium floods back into the cell, triggering a cascade of damage.
This calcium release activates pathways that break down muscle protein faster than the body builds it back up. It generates bursts of oxidative stress that damage cellular components. It releases mitochondrial DNA that the immune system mistakes for bacterial invasion, triggering inflammation.
Each pathway drives muscle loss without requiring energy failure. The mitochondria still produce ATP normally. They've just lost the ability to prevent calcium from activating destructive programs that eat away at muscle tissue.
The study measured calcium handling by exposing muscle mitochondria to calcium loads and tracking retention. Both active and inactive participants showed declining capacity, but the pattern matters. Calcium handling remained relatively stable from ages 20 to 60, then dropped sharply after 70.
Calcium retention capacity correlated with thigh muscle mass, knee strength, walking distance, and mobility performance. It also correlated with GDF15, a stress molecule that rises with aging and predicts worse health outcomes. This suggests calcium handling directly influences muscle health and systemic aging markers.
Physical activity protected functional performance. Active participants outperformed inactive individuals on strength and mobility tests across all age groups. But both groups showed age-related declines. Exercise delays deterioration but doesn't eliminate it.
Muscle fiber composition revealed how activity and aging affect muscle differently. Active young adults had more type I endurance fibers that stayed stable across decades. Inactive individuals showed fiber type changes suggesting nerve disconnection from muscle that active individuals avoided.
Intermuscular fat, the marbling that accumulates in muscle tissue, increased with aging in both groups. But physical activity provided protection in later decades. Older active individuals had less fat infiltration than older inactive individuals, though the protective effect only emerged after years of consistent activity.
The implications challenge decades of research direction. Drug development targeting mitochondrial energy production in aging muscle produced zero effective treatments. This study suggests those efforts addressed the wrong problem. Energy production itself doesn't decline with healthy aging.
Calcium handling deterioration appears to be the actual mechanism driving muscle loss.
Restoring calcium buffering capacity or preventing the permeability transition pore from opening prematurely may represent more effective intervention points than trying to boost energy production or mitochondrial numbers.
There are some limitations that stand out when you read the paper:
First, only men participated. So findings may not apply equally to women.
Participants were relatively healthy community-dwelling adults, not people with severe muscle wasting. The design prevents establishing whether calcium handling failure causes muscle loss or just accompanies it.
With that being said, the data fundamentally reframe what aging does to muscle. Energy failure on per mitochondria level isn't the driver in healthy aging. Inactivity reduces mitochondrial numbers while aging leaves energy production intact. The exception, calcium handling deterioration occurring regardless of activity, appears to be where aging actually operates.
"They didn't get heart disease and cancer in the past because they weren't living long enough to get them."
Third time this week. It turns up within four replies of anything I post, always from someone who thinks he has just closed the case.
The most common age of death in England in 1841, for anyone who got past ten, was 75.6.
That is the government's own number, on the government's own website, where it has been sitting the entire time.
Forty is the life expectancy at birth, and it is an average, and averages are stupid in a way people refuse to accept about them. Bury a hundred babies and a hundred pensioners in the same parish and the average comes out at thirty-eight, and nobody in that parish died at thirty-eight.
Take the infants out and the whole argument falls over. A child in 1841 who made it to five had a coin-flip chance of reaching sixty. No antibiotics, cholera in the water, and a tenth of the cohort made eighty.
And they still miss the actual point, which is that these are not diseases of time. They are diseases of a body being fed something it was never built to run on.
Type 2 diabetes used to be called adult-onset diabetes. They had to change the name. Somebody sat in a committee and formally renamed a disease, in the medical literature, because eleven-year-olds kept turning up with it and the old name was getting embarrassing to say out loud in a children's clinic.
That is not a disease waiting for people to get old. That is a disease that stopped waiting.
Meanwhile a research team took CT scanners into the Bolivian Amazon and scanned the Tsimane. Two thirds of the over-seventy-fives had no coronary calcium whatsoever. A Tsimane grandmother of eighty has the arteries of an American woman in her fifties.
She got old. She got old without any of it.
Our ancestors were not dying before they had a chance to get sick. They were dying of things we have since fixed, and living into their seventies without the things we have since invented.
The eleven-year-old in the diabetes clinic did not get there by living too long.

A superfood is not discovered. It is commissioned, and one family in California did the whole thing in public.
Stewart and Lynda Resnick bought a pistachio orchard with some pomegranate trees on it and kept them because the return per acre was better. Then Lynda Resnick did the thing she is genuinely brilliant at. She went and bought the science.
By 2012 they had put more than $35 million into pomegranate research and had 70 studies published in peer-reviewed journals. In 2007 the company spent more on research than on advertising, $17 million against $12 million, and she said publicly that she was proud of it. One peer reviewer rejected a manuscript for being excessively advocatory of pomegranate juice as a treatment for prostate cancer. It was published elsewhere.
Then the advertising, quoting the research they had paid for. The juice could treat, prevent or reduce the risk of heart disease. Prostate cancer. Erectile dysfunction. Clinically proven. One billboard put the little bottle under a hangman's noose and the words Cheat Death.
The Federal Trade Commission found deceptive claims across 36 advertisements and promotional materials. The order named both Resnicks personally and runs for twenty years. In 2015 the DC Circuit affirmed it. In 2016 the Supreme Court declined to hear the appeal.
After the ruling, they gave UCLA $4 million to start a Food Law and Policy Program.
And none of that is the expensive part.
The Wonderful Company holds around 185,000 acres of California, fifteen million trees drinking on the order of 120 billion gallons a year, more than any other private interest in the American West. To feed it they hold a 57% controlling stake in the Kern Water Bank, 32 square miles storing up to 1.5 million acre-feet underground, built with over $70 million of state money for public drought relief and handed into private control in 1994.
So when the droughts came the family holding the bank were insulated from the thing everyone else was suffering, and could sell water back into the system that had paid to dig it. In a bad year they outbid every other farmer in the valley. Neighbours grub out orchards. The nut acreage stays in the ground.
That is what the little bottle costs.
The verdict changed nothing. It sits in the chiller today at the same price, beside the word antioxidant, sold to people who have never heard of the Kern Water Bank and could not find Kern County on a map of the state whose drought they read about every summer.
A superfood is a crop somebody owns a lot of, with a laboratory on retainer and a media buy behind it.

The woman who led the design of America's food pyramid spent her later years saying one thing. The version you were taught was not hers.
Luise Light was a nutritionist recruited by the USDA in the early 1980s to lead the team building America's new food guide. By her own published account, her team's version put 5 to 9 daily servings of fruits and vegetables at the base, with grains as a small allowance, strictly whole grain.
Then, she says, the guide came back from the Secretary of Agriculture's office changed. Grains, any grains, refined included, inflated to 6 to 11 servings a day and moved to the base of the pyramid. Her fruits and vegetables cut back. "Eat less" softened into "avoid too much."
She wrote that she protested at the time, warning the changes would lead to an epidemic of obesity and diabetes. She called the refined-grain load frightening, because the body processes it like sugar.
The industry pressure is documented beyond her account: the pyramid's 1991 release was withdrawn under meat and dairy lobby pressure and re-released in 1992 after nearly a million dollars of re-testing. Every American classroom got the result.
The USDA maintains the pyramid reflected the science of its era. Look at the era that followed, and decide how her warning aged. Hers had vegetables at the bottom. Yours had bread.

The plant-based longevity argument rests on five places where nobody can prove how old anybody is.
That is the whole of it. Every documentary, every retreat, every book about beans and purpose and moving naturally, every doctor on a stage with a photograph of a smiling old man behind him, traces back to a handful of regions selected because they reported unusual numbers of people over a hundred.
Saul Newman at University College London did the job nobody else had bothered with, which was to check whether the old men were old.
What actually predicts a region producing supercentenarians:
- High poverty
- No birth certificates
- Bad death registration
- Relatively few people aged 90
- Short life expectancy for its own country
Diet is nowhere on that list. Neither is exercise, wine, sunshine, community, purpose, or any of the other furniture they sell you on the way out of the gift shop.
Of the world's exhaustively validated supercentenarians, 18 per cent hold a birth certificate. America has over 500 of them and seven certificates between the lot.
Their birthdays cluster on the first of the month and on dates divisible by five, which is what a number looks like when it was remembered rather than recorded.
Introduce birth certificates to a region and its supply of 110-year-olds falls by between 69 and 82 per cent. The beans stayed. The centenarians left.
Japan went through its own registers in 2010 and could not account for more than two hundred thousand people listed as being over a hundred. Nobody has suggested the Okinawan diet is responsible for that.
Sardinia, Okinawa and Ikaria came out poorer, less literate, more criminal and shorter-lived than their own national averages. Those are not the conditions that produce the oldest people on earth. They are the conditions that produce the worst records on earth, and for twenty years the second thing has been read as the first.
Newman took the first Ig Nobel Prize in Demography for this in 2024, and thanked the world's oldest man for having three birthdays.
Twenty years, four hundred cookbooks, a Netflix series and a chain of certified longevity towns, built on villages that could not tell you what year it was.
The old man in the photograph is real enough.
The number printed underneath him came from his family, and there is a pension attached to it.

In 1938 a committee of psychiatrists told the British government that bombing would produce three times as many mental casualties as physical ones. Three to four million cases in the first six months.
The state believed them and built a network of emergency psychiatric clinics outside the city centres, staffed and waiting for the collapse.
The bombs came. Forty thousand civilians killed in eight months. A million London homes damaged or destroyed. People slept in the Underground, came up to find the street gone, and went to work.
The clinics closed for lack of patients. In the first three months of the Blitz London recorded around two cases of bomb neurosis a week. Suicides fell. Drunkenness fell.
That is a population on dripping, offal, eggs, whole milk and Sunday joints, being bombed nightly, and not breaking.
Their grandchildren: over eight million adults in England on antidepressants, close to ninety million prescriptions a year, one in five people aged eight to twenty-five with a probable mental disorder. Warm, fed, housed, at peace, and being bombed by nobody.

A US senator walked up to an airport checkpoint and refused to have his face scanned.
His name is Jeff Merkley. He is the senator from Oregon. He has spent three years trying to get the TSA to tell travelers something the TSA already admits on its own website.
The face scan at the checkpoint is optional. Almost nobody is told.
There is one sentence that stops it. Here is the sentence, and everything the TSA does not want you to know about saying it.
First, the TSA's own words. From the TSA website:
"Travelers who do not wish to participate in the facial recognition technology process may decline the optional photo, without recourse, in favor of an alternative identity verification process, which does not use facial recognition technology to verify their identity."
Optional photo. Without recourse. Those are their words, not mine.
The TSA also says this on the same page:
"Travelers will not lose their place in line for security screening."
And using the alternative method "does not take longer."
So the two things a TSA agent might tell you at the checkpoint, that you will hold up the line or take longer, are ruled out by the TSA's own website.
Now the sentence. When you get to the checkpoint, before the scan, say this:
"I do not consent to the scan and would like to have my ID manually verified."
That is it.
The officer will take your physical ID, either a driver's license or a passport, and check the photo against your face the way they did for the last twenty years. Merkley has documented himself doing this on flights between DC and Portland.
Here is why almost no one knows.
Senator Merkley has been pushing this since July 2023. He went to Reagan Washington National Airport that summer to publicly demonstrate the opt-out and to challenge the TSA on how the program is being run. The Washington Post covered it.
In May 2025, Merkley introduced the Traveler Privacy Protection Act with Senators John Kennedy of Louisiana, Ed Markey of Massachusetts, and Roger Marshall of Kansas. Two Republicans, two Democrats. The bill is endorsed by the American Civil Liberties Union, the Electronic Privacy Information Center, Public Citizen, and three other watchdog groups.
Merkley's own words from that press release:
"Folks don't want a national surveillance state, but that's exactly what the TSA's unchecked expansion of facial recognition technology is leading us to."
And:
"Americans have the right to opt out of using TSA's facial recognition at the airport, and we need to protect that right. Our Traveler Privacy Protection Act safeguards the freedoms and privacy of all Americans by making sure no one is required to have their face scanned to travel."
Here is what the TSA is planning.
Facial recognition is currently at more than 84 US airports. The TSA plans to expand it to more than 430. That is nearly every commercial airport in the country. And per the bill's findings, the TSA is "eventually planning to make this technology mandatory for all travelers."
Right now it is optional. That window is closing.
The TSA says the technology is not being abused. Their exact wording:
"Biometrics are not used for surveillance. Facial recognition technology is solely used to automate the current manual ID credential checking process and will not be used for surveillance or any law enforcement purpose."
Take them at their word. The point is not that the TSA is doing something illegal. The point is you get to choose.
Here is the 5-minute action you can take tonight, before your next flight.
- Memorize the sentence: "I do not consent to the scan and would like to have my ID manually verified."
- Have your physical ID out and ready. Driver's license or passport. Not a screenshot on your phone.
- When you get to the podium, hand the agent your ID and say the sentence in a normal tone. Do not apologize.
- If the agent pushes back or tells you it will take longer, calmly repeat the sentence. If they still refuse, ask for a supervisor.
- This applies to TSA checkpoints only. International arrivals into the US go through Customs and Border Protection, which is a different agency with different rules. For most US domestic flights, the sentence above is what you need.
